ThreatDown vs. Vault: Detailed Comparison

ThreatDown vs. Vault Top Ratings & Reviews: ThreatDown

In our rating and review comparison of ThreatDown vs. Vault, ThreatDown has 122 user reviews and Vault has 15. The average star rating for ThreatDown is 4.69 while Vault has an average rating of 4.4. ThreatDown has more positive reviews than Vault. Comparing ThreatDown vs. Vault reviews, ThreatDown has stronger overall reviews.
